Overview: We are seeking a detail-oriented Maintenance Technician to maintain and repair electronic and mechanical equipment in a medical device manufacturing environment. The role requires adherence to cGMP standards, facility quality systems, and safety regulations while supporting continuous improvement and engineering projects.
Key Responsibilities:
Troubleshoot, diagnose, and repair electronic, mechanical, hydraulic, and pneumatic equipment.
Perform preventive maintenance (PMs) to ensure reliable operations.
Maintain an accurate spare parts inventory (fabricated and commercial).
Support engineering projects, including equipment installation, qualifications (IQs), and upgrades.
Participate in continuous improvement initiatives to reduce costs, improve reliability, and minimize waste.
Test and repair electronic circuits using oscilloscopes, voltmeters, amp meters, and signal generators.
Install, modify, and maintain control panel wiring and assist with PLC ladder logic program adjustments.
Train operators and assist with machine setups and operations.
Collaborate with tool room and central crib teams to ensure timely repairs and parts availability.
Propose and review design changes with engineers to improve product quality and reduce recurring issues.
Be available for off-shift call-ups and flexible to work overtime as needed.
Education:
High School Diploma or GED (Required).
Associate's Degree in a technical field (Preferred).
In lieu of degree: minimum of 2 years of technical experience.
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ities:
Proficient in hydraulic, electric, mechanical, and pneumatic systems.
Proficient in reading blueprints and schematics.
Basic computer skills (SAP, Excel, Word).
Ability to maintain accurate records.
Strong troubleshooting and problem-solving skills.
Ability to read, write, and converse in English.
Commitment to company values, quality systems, and regulatory compliance.
